Scoot Henderson GOES OFF PLAYOFF CAREER-HIGH 31 PTS (5 3PM) In Game 2 🔥 | April 21, 2026

Scoot Henderson put on a show with 31 PTS on 11-17 shooting (5 3PM) to lead the Trail Blazers to a 106-103 win over the Spurs, evening the series at 1-1. Portland closed the game on a dominant 16-4 run over the final five minutes to secure the victory in a back-and-forth battle that featured…

Published

on

Scoot Henderson put on a show with 31 PTS on 11-17 shooting (5 3PM) to lead the Trail Blazers to a 106-103 win over the Spurs, evening the series at 1-1.

Portland closed the game on a dominant 16-4 run over the final five minutes to secure the victory in a back-and-forth battle that featured 9 lead changes and 9 ties.

Jrue Holiday added 16 PTS, 9 AST, and 5 REB, helping control the game down the stretch.

For San Antonio, Stephon Castle led with 18 PTS, while De’Aaron Fox added 17 PTS and 3 STL.

Scoot continues his strong playoff start—his 49 total points through two games ties Damian Lillard for the 2nd-most by a Trail Blazer in their first two playoff games since 2000, trailing only Brandon Roy (63).

Blazers lock in late and head home with momentum for Game 3.

#7 TRAIL BLAZERS at #2 SPURS | FULL GAME 2 HIGHLIGHTS | April 21, 2026

The Trail Blazers ended the game on a 24-8 run to defeat the Spurs, 106-103. The Trail Blazers were led by the 31 points and 5 three pointers from Scoot Henderson, while Jrue Holiday also added 16 points. The Spurs were led by Stephon Castle, who had 18 points and 7 rebounds and 5 assists.…

Published

on

The Trail Blazers ended the game on a 24-8 run to defeat the Spurs, 106-103. The Trail Blazers were led by the 31 points and 5 three pointers from Scoot Henderson, while Jrue Holiday also added 16 points. The Spurs were led by Stephon Castle, who had 18 points and 7 rebounds and 5 assists. The Trail Blazers tie the series up at 1 games each.
